The Evolution of SaaS Affiliate Programs

In recent years, the affiliate marketing landscape has shifted significantly. Traditional affiliate programs focused on physical products, but the rise of digital services has paved the way for SaaS affiliate programs. These programs offer unique opportunities for both affiliates and businesses. They provide recurring revenue models, allowing affiliates to earn ongoing commissions as long as the customer remains subscribed.

Why SaaS Affiliate Programs Are Gaining Popularity

The popularity of SaaS affiliate programs can be attributed to several factors. Firstly, the subscription-based model provides a stable and predictable income stream. Affiliates benefit from the recurring nature of SaaS products, which often have high retention rates. Furthermore, SaaS companies typically offer competitive commission rates, sometimes as high as 30% per sale.

How to Choose the Right SaaS Affiliate Programs

Selecting the right SaaS affiliate program is critical for success. Here are some actionable tips:

  • Research the Product: Ensure the SaaS product aligns with your audience's needs and interests.
  • Evaluate the Commission Structure: Look for programs offering sustainable and competitive commissions.
  • Assess the Support Provided: Choose programs that offer marketing materials and dedicated affiliate support.
  • Consider the Brand's Reputation: Partner with reputable SaaS companies to maintain trust with your audience.

Common Pitfalls and How to Avoid Them

While SaaS affiliate programs offer numerous benefits, there are common pitfalls to avoid:

  • Overreliance on a Single Program: Diversify your affiliate partnerships to mitigate risks.
  • Neglecting Content Quality: Maintain high-quality content to build trust and credibility with your audience.
  • Ignoring Analytics: Regularly review performance data to identify areas for improvement.

Future Trends in SaaS Affiliate Marketing

As the SaaS industry continues to grow, affiliate marketing will evolve with it. We can expect to see more personalized marketing strategies, driven by AI and machine learning. Additionally, with the increasing importance of data privacy, affiliates will need to adapt by ensuring compliance with regulations like GDPR and CCPA.

What is a SaaS affiliate program?

A SaaS affiliate program is a marketing strategy where affiliates promote a software-as-a-service product and earn a commission for each sale or subscription generated through their efforts.

How do I start with SaaS affiliate marketing?

To start with SaaS affiliate marketing, research potential programs, sign up as an affiliate, and begin promoting the SaaS products through your channels, such as blogs, social media, or email marketing.

What makes SaaS affiliate programs different from traditional ones?

SaaS affiliate programs differ from traditional ones due to their subscription-based model, allowing affiliates to earn recurring commissions as customers renew their subscriptions.
